Responsibilities
- Develop and maintain a successful platform of people, processes, and technology to deliver on our culture and purpose
- Recognize opportunities and work collaboratively to design and implement solutions for clinic operations
- Act as project manager for clinic acquisitions, moves, and openings within the region
- Meet regularly with clinic leadership (Providers, Office Managers, and/or Team Leads) to provide up-to-date reporting of metrics and solve challenges
- Guide, coach, and drive the team to meet and exceed our goals
- Cooklead and oversee Whiteboard Program in conjunction with Office Managers or Team Leads
- Lead Care Coordination efforts in conjunction with Health Services to work proactive outreach call lists
- Recruit, develop, train, and motivate a best-in-class care team
- Engage in proactive outreach to passive candidates, utilizing referrals from existing team members
- Aid in scheduling interviews with clinic teams and serve as a communication conduit for all recruiting processes within assigned clinics
- Create training plans for individual team members based on skill set
- Conduct bi-weekly follow-ups for new team members
- Ensure completion and submission of Clinical Competency checklists for each new team member
- Counsel and coach Office Managers and Team Leads on leadership tactics
- Directly manage Office Managers in the region and teams without Office Managers
- Provide operational oversight and support to providers (physicians and mid-levels)
- Onboard new team members with orientation to VIPcare culture and monitor/design training programs as necessary
- Collaborate effectively with other operational team leaders and physicians
- Serve as liaison and oversight for clinic improvements and problem-solving related to IT, Facilities, VIP Helpline, Network Operations, and other internal departments
- Identify areas of strategic growth within the region for new office expansion
- Assist with Physician Recruitment to regional clinics
- Steer clinic growth in conjunction with the Marketing Team
Position Requirements/ Skills
- At least 5 years of experience within a healthcare or clinical management setting
- Direct management of teams and communication with physicians
- Experience building and cultivating clinic teams
- Ability to work independently with minimal supervision
- Proficient with Google Suite (Drive, Docs, Sheets, Slides) and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, PowerPoint) for real-time collaboration
